Mountain View Art & Wine Festival Returns to Celebrate Creativity, Culture, and Community
The award-winning Mountain View Art & Wine Festival, presented by the Mountain View Chamber of Commerce, returns to Castro Street in Downtown Mountain View on Saturday, September 6 from 11 a.m. to 7 p.m. and Sunday, September 7 from 10 a.m. to 6 p.m. This free-admission celebration promises a weekend filled with art, music, gourmet food and drink, and an unmistakable community spirit in the heart of Silicon Valley.
A Sensory Wonderland
Now in its 53rd year, the festival transforms Castro Street into a lively outdoor marketplace and cultural celebration. Visitors can stroll among 400 booths of thoughtfully curated, all-original works by world-class artists, sample exceptional wines and craft beverages, enjoy live music on two stages, and discover unique experiences around every corner.

New This Year: The Wine Tasting Experience
Step into this exclusive lounge area for a curated tasting journey through California’s most celebrated wine regions. Guests will enjoy more than 22 pours from 12 distinguished wineries, meet the vintners, and learn the stories behind their craft. Whether you are a seasoned wine enthusiast or simply curious, this experience offers a chance to explore varietals from Anarchist Wine Co., Concannon Vineyard, Darcie Kent Estate Winery, Defiance Vineyard, Elaine Wines, Frey Vineyards, Inspiration Vineyards, J. Lohr, Patent Wines, Riel Wines, Seven Oxen Estate Wines, Shale Oak Winery, and Sterling Vineyards.

Live Music and Entertainment
The PG&E Main Stage will pulse with a diverse lineup, from pop and funk to rock and dance, featuring perennial favorites the Megatones and the House Rockers, as well as The Hootenanny!, Tsunami, Shake It Booty Band, and Livewire.
Interactive and Immersive Experiences
The Xfinity Sports Lounge gives fans the chance to catch live games on a massive SkyVision screen. With seating, nearby food and beverages, and a relaxed atmosphere, it’s the perfect spot to unwind, grab a bite, and immerse yourself in the game.
The Collaborative Paint Temple invites guests to take part in a shared art project set to melodic house music from live DJs. This year’s theme, “My Superpower Is…”, invites attendees to reflect on their personal strengths and express them creatively. Over the course of the weekend, the community’s contributions will transform the temple into a vibrant mosaic of color, culminating in an entirely new work of art by Sunday evening, created by and for the community.
Family-Friendly Fun
The Alamo Drafthouse–sponsored Kid Zone is packed with activities and attractions for all ages, including games, face painting, bungee trampolines, and “water balls” that let kids walk on water inside giant inflatable orbs.
The Alamo Drafthouse Community Stage showcases emerging local talent; singers, dancers, actors, musicians, and more. “The Community Stage truly captures the spirit of our festival,” says Peter Katz of the Mountain View Chamber of Commerce. “It’s become a favorite among guests, and it’s always inspiring to see the incredible range of talent our community has to offer.”

Spotlight on Local Artist: Ellen Fu
This year’s festival design contest winner is Ellen Fu, a Mountain View-based artist who works primarily in watercolor and digital media. The vision for this year’s festival design centers on the "spark" of creativity and connection that both art and wine bring to people who enjoy them. It reflects the energy and harmony that local artists and winemakers pour into their craft--the swirls of their efforts, iteration, and inspiration coming together in their creations. Set against the backdrop of our peninsula's mountain ranges, this piece invites viewers into the spirit of creativity and community that connects creators and festival-goers in Mountain View.
